Understanding Filters in Graphic Design
Filters in graphic design software and tools are visual effects or adjustments applied to elements, images, or graphics to alter their appearance. They serve as powerful functions that allow designers to quickly and efficiently change how an image or design element looks without having to manually adjust every single pixel or property.
Based on the reference, filters are primarily used to:
- Enhance Appearance: Improve the quality or impact of an image.
- Modify Visual Properties: Directly change specific attributes.
Filters can be used to enhance or modify the color, contrast, saturation, brightness, or other visual properties of an element to achieve desired visual effects or create a specific mood or style.
Practical Applications and Types
The application of filters varies widely depending on the desired outcome, from subtle corrections to dramatic artistic transformations.
- Correction and Enhancement:
- Adjusting Brightness and Contrast to improve visibility.
- Correcting Color Balance or White Balance.
- Sharpening or blurring details.
- Artistic and Stylistic Effects:
- Applying textures (e.g., grain, noise).
- Simulating painting or drawing styles.
- Distorting images for unique effects.
- Preparation for Print or Web:
- Converting color modes.
- Optimizing resolution.
Here are some common categories of filters found in graphic design software:
- Adjustment Filters: Alter properties like levels, curves, exposure, hue, saturation, and color balance.
- Blur Filters: Reduce detail and create softness (e.g., Gaussian Blur, Motion Blur).
- Sharpen Filters: Enhance edges and details.
- Artistic Filters: Apply effects that mimic traditional art media (e.g., Watercolor, Oil Paint).
- Distort Filters: Reshape or warp images (e.g., Twirl, Pinch).
- Texture Filters: Add surface textures or patterns.
Using filters allows designers to save significant time compared to making manual adjustments, while also enabling creative exploration and achieving consistent visual styles across projects.
